黑狐家游戏

深入解析PHPcms v9服务器,性能优化与安全防护之道,phpcms v9官网

欧气 1 0

本文目录导读:

深入解析PHPcms v9服务器,性能优化与安全防护之道,phpcms v9官网

图片来源于网络,如有侵权联系删除

  1. PHPcms v9服务器性能优化
  2. PHPcms v9服务器安全防护

随着互联网技术的飞速发展,网站建设已经成为企业展示形象、拓展市场的重要手段,PHPcms v9作为一款功能强大的内容管理系统,在众多网站建设中占据了一席之地,本文将深入解析PHPcms v9服务器,从性能优化与安全防护两个方面,为广大用户带来实用技巧。

PHPcms v9服务器性能优化

1、服务器硬件配置

服务器硬件配置是影响网站性能的关键因素,在PHPcms v9服务器中,以下硬件配置建议:

(1)CPU:建议使用四核以上CPU,如Intel i5、i7或AMD Ryzen 5、7等。

(2)内存:建议配置8GB以上内存,可根据实际需求进行扩展。

(3)硬盘:建议使用SSD硬盘,提高读写速度,提升网站性能。

2、服务器软件配置

(1)操作系统:推荐使用CentOS 7或Ubuntu 18.04等稳定、安全的操作系统。

(2)Web服务器:推荐使用Nginx或Apache,Nginx具有更高的性能和稳定性。

(3)PHP版本:推荐使用PHP 7.4或更高版本,PHP 7.4以上版本在性能和安全性方面均有较大提升。

(4)数据库:推荐使用MySQL 5.7或更高版本,支持更丰富的功能和更好的性能。

3、代码优化

深入解析PHPcms v9服务器,性能优化与安全防护之道,phpcms v9官网

图片来源于网络,如有侵权联系删除

(1)减少数据库查询:尽量使用缓存技术,如Redis、Memcached等,减少数据库查询次数。

(2)优化SQL语句:对SQL语句进行优化,减少执行时间。

(3)减少外部调用:尽量减少外部调用,如API接口、第三方插件等,降低网站性能损耗。

(4)代码规范:遵循代码规范,提高代码可读性和可维护性。

PHPcms v9服务器安全防护

1、服务器安全设置

(1)修改默认端口:将Web服务器默认端口修改为非标准端口,如8080,降低攻击风险。

(2)禁用不必要的功能:关闭Web服务器、数据库等不必要的功能,减少攻击面。

(3)限制访问IP:设置白名单或黑名单,限制访问IP,防止恶意攻击。

2、PHP安全设置

(1)禁用危险函数:禁用PHP中可能引发安全问题的函数,如exec、shell_exec等。

(2)设置PHP目录权限:将PHP目录权限设置为755,防止恶意用户修改文件。

(3)开启PHP安全模式:开启PHP安全模式,提高网站安全性。

深入解析PHPcms v9服务器,性能优化与安全防护之道,phpcms v9官网

图片来源于网络,如有侵权联系删除

3、数据库安全设置

(1)设置强密码:为数据库用户设置强密码,防止恶意用户猜测。

(2)备份数据库:定期备份数据库,防止数据丢失。

(3)限制访问权限:仅允许必要的数据库用户访问数据库,降低攻击风险。

4、代码安全

(1)输入验证:对用户输入进行验证,防止SQL注入、XSS攻击等。

(2)文件上传:严格限制文件上传类型,防止恶意文件上传。

(3)权限控制:实现用户权限控制,防止用户越权操作。

PHPcms v9服务器在性能优化与安全防护方面具有较高的可塑性,通过合理配置硬件、软件,优化代码,加强安全设置,可以有效提升网站性能和安全性,在实际应用中,还需根据具体情况进行调整,确保网站稳定、安全地运行。

标签: #phpcms v9 服务器

黑狐家游戏
  • 评论列表

留言评论